Note dei viaggiatori su Yakushima in settembre

Yakushima-forum threads on rain discuss this island's reputation as one of Japan's genuinely wetter destinations, September overlapping with typhoon season and capable of bringing real disruption to travel plans and ferry schedules. Posters describe conditions as still warm, summer-like temperatures lingering through the month, comfortable enough for light clothing even as the rain risk climbs. Regulars are consistent when it rains here it tends to come down hard rather than as a gentle drizzle, proper gear genuinely essential for any trek toward the Jomon Cedar or Shiratani Unsui Gorge. Posters call September still a workable trekking month despite the risk, slightly calmer temperatures than peak summer making the walk more comfortable. Regulars recommend building real flexibility into any itinerary given how disruptive a typhoon can be to onward travel. The record: 22.4C days feeling like 24C, 20.5C nights, an extraordinarily high 246mm across over 18 days and 80 percent humidity.

Yakushima-forum reviews on an August visit describe an early five-thirty a.m. start as genuinely necessary, one hiker recalling it was already bright by then and the trail still felt genuinely warm despite tree cover for much of the route. Regulars call the Jomon Sugi round trip a real full-day commitment, several posters naming roughly twenty-two kilometers and ten hours as standard for the out-and-back. Posters call most of the route genuinely easy railway-track walking, several regulars naming real rock-scrambling only in the final stretch near the ancient cedar itself. Regulars call carrying food and water genuinely essential, several threads warning no shops exist anywhere along the trail. Posters recommend a real early start regardless of season, several regulars calling this standard given how long and demanding the full round trip is. The record: 23.8C days, 21.8C nights, an extraordinarily high 195.6mm across over 14 days and 82 percent humidity.

Yakushima-forum threads on rain here are blunt this island is famously wet essentially year-round, the interior receiving some of the highest rainfall totals in Japan and locals only half-joking it falls thirty-five days most months. Posters call real waterproof gear non-negotiable, fast-wicking layers and proper wool socks named repeatedly as standing packing advice. Regulars describe guides as routinely adjusting hikes on the fly for safety, a planned route sometimes swapped for a lower-risk alternative with little notice. Posters call rental waterproofs and boots widely available on the island for anyone arriving underprepared. Regulars describe hiking through steady rain as entirely normal here, most visitors reporting no real problem once dressed appropriately. Posters call the ancient cedar forests worth the trip regardless of forecast. Cosa c'è in programma a Yakushima in settembre

Eventi stagionali ricorrenti, spettacoli naturali, chiusure e festività: selezionati e con fonte.

  • Rischio

    Typhoon season

    15 lug – 15 ott · di solitoChiusure

    The ferry and the hydrofoil from Kagoshima stop a day before a storm and do not restart for a day after. Budget a spare day either end of a trip in this window. Fonte ↗
